Renault will decide its F1 future by the end of 2015
Renault's future in Formula 1 will become clear toward the end of the 2015 season according to Renault Sport F1 managing director Cyril Abiteboul. The French manufacturer and engine supplier to Red Bull and Toro Rosso is currently weighing up its future, with three options on the table: to remain an engine supplier, increase its involvement, or quit the sport completely. At present, it isn't clear which path is the preferred one, only that the company doesn't feel it is getting the recognition and therefore the marketing return it deserves, particularly for its part in powering Red Bull to four constructors' championships.
